This past weekend i had the opportunity to do my first single stage paint correction. My co-worker whos Suzuki i did last week asked me to clean up his pickup. It's a 1995 Nissan Hardbody with 57k original miles.

Process:
APC 4:1 for all jambs
Wash with 2 bucket, Megs Deep Crystal Wash
Clayed with Megs white clay and QD
UC via orange pad, PC7424XP speed 5
M205 via black pad, PC7424XP speed 5
x2 NXT 2.0 via red pad, PC7424XP speed 3

I started with thoroughly going over all the jambs with APC and various brushes as well as the wheel wells.

After washing with Megs Deep Crystal Wash, i see the real condition of the paint:

I then clayed the entire truck using Megs white clay with QD as lube.

There were several stains and marks all over the paint:

I proceeded with a test spot using UC before stepping up to the 105. The UC seemed to be enough to remove the oxidation paired with an Orange pad.

The UC cleaned up a good 90-95% of all the defects / oxidation / marks on the paint. I then followed up with Megs 205 on black finishing pad and topped with 2 coats of NXT 2.0 on red pad.

The chrome was pretty hazed so i took some chrome cleaner and a 4" black finishing pad and hit all the chrome and it cleaned up real nice.

Didnt get pics but the inside was vaccumed, dressed and all windows done.
